When growing tomatoes, should the soil be acid or sweet?

I would like to plant tomatoes this season, but I don’t know how to prepare the soil. I was thinking of using lime to sweeten the soil, but I wasn’t sure if tomatoes grow well in that kind of soil. If they need acid soil, please provide the necessary information.

Check your soil conditions and soil pH, which should be in the 6 to 6.5 range. Also, the soil should consist of organic matter, usually in the form of compost or well rotted manure, with sufficient amounts of fertilizer and moisture.
